Jonathan Rico 76f74344a8 Shell: kernel: Add runtime log filtering command
Use `kernel log-level modulename severity`
Also enable it for the Bluetooth Shell.

Then one can compile-in a lot of BT modules like so:

CONFIG_BT_DEBUG_HCI_CORE=y
CONFIG_BT_DEBUG_L2CAP=y
CONFIG_BT_DEBUG_ATT=y
CONFIG_BT_DEBUG_GATT=y

And at runtime select only, e.g. GATT

kernel log-level bt_hci_core 0
kernel log-level bt_l2cap 0
kernel log-level bt_att 0

And then re-enable L2CAP if needed later

kernel log-level bt_l2cap 4

And so on..
